Walter in the Woods is a book written by Mrs. Samuel Greg that provides a detailed and illustrated description of the trees and common objects found in the forest. The book is centered around the character of Walter, a young boy who is taken on a journey through the woods by his father. As they explore the forest, Walter learns about the different types of trees, leaves, flowers, and animals that inhabit the area. The book is designed to be both educational and engaging, with colorful illustrations and easy-to-understand descriptions that make it accessible to readers of all ages.
